And I bought my shocks in January I believe I first tried to buy from a auto part store that specialize in racing I can't remember the name of it now but it's on the post thing I put on my shock and install if you look for it on these forums. Wound up buying all eight from shock Warehouse. I purchased a but they came a couple at a time so I guess they sent him from different warehouses. That transaction was shock Warehouse was no issue. But when I tried to buy my rear shocks for my Jeep Grand Cherokee as well as new airbags for the back of the Jeep I had major issues. I finally did get them seems that they were out of stock but they never communicated that to me just took the money. I tried repeatedly to get hold of them both by email on site communication tool as well as calling repeatedly never got a hold of a person never got a call back or an email back until they came in stock and the guy called me to find out if that's where I still wanted them shipped. They had no idea that I had been calling or leaving messages or emails. I was pretty unhappy with that but I purchased them anyway cuz one of my back shocks on the jeep was bad and I wanted to replace both of them. Hopefully your experience will be different but I would buy them from shock Warehouse again. If they say out of stock then don't order them until they come back in stock would be my opinion and advice. Generally I think you're going to find that most places are going to be the same price probably set by Koni.
